制作AI智能数字人是一项涉及多学科技术的综合任务,它结合了计算机科学、人工智能、语言学、心理学和艺术设计等多个领域的知识。以下是制作AI智能数字人的步骤和相关技术:
1. 需求分析与规划
- 目标设定:明确AI数字人的目标,例如提供客户服务、教育辅导或娱乐互动等。
- 功能规划:确定AI数字人需要具备哪些功能,如语音识别、自然语言处理、情感计算等。
- 用户研究:了解目标用户群体的需求和偏好,进行用户画像的创建。
2. 技术选型
- 编程语言:选择合适的编程语言来构建AI数字人的基础框架。
- 机器学习库:利用深度学习框架如TensorFlow或PyTorch进行模型训练。
- 自然语言处理工具:使用NLP工具如NLTK或SpaCy处理文本数据。
- 语音合成技术:选择适合的语音合成引擎,如Google Text-to-Speech或Amazon Polly。
- 图像处理技术:如果AI数字人需要展示图像,则需使用图像处理技术来生成或处理图像。
3. 数据收集与处理
- 语音数据:收集大量的语音样本用于训练和测试。
- 文本数据:收集大量文本数据用于训练和测试。
- 图像数据:收集高质量的图片用于训练和测试。
- 用户交互数据:收集用户与AI数字人的交互数据,用于优化AI模型。
4. 模型设计与训练
- 模型架构:根据需求选择合适的神经网络架构,如循环神经网络(RNN)、长短期记忆网络(LSTM)或Transformer等。
- 数据预处理:对文本、语音等数据进行清洗和格式化。
- 模型训练:使用收集到的数据对模型进行训练,调整模型参数以达到最佳效果。
- 验证与测试:在独立的数据集上验证模型的效果,并进行测试以确保模型的准确性和可靠性。
5. 界面设计与交互
- 用户界面设计:设计友好的用户界面,确保用户能够轻松地与AI数字人进行交互。
- 交互逻辑:开发交互逻辑,使用户能够通过语音命令或文字输入与AI数字人进行交流。
- 反馈机制:设计有效的反馈机制,让用户知道他们的输入被正确理解和处理。
6. 部署与维护
- 系统部署:将AI数字人部署到服务器或云平台上。
- 持续维护:定期更新模型和系统以适应新的需求和改进用户体验。
- 性能监控:监控AI数字人的性能,确保其稳定运行并及时响应用户需求。
7. 应用与推广
- 应用场景探索:探索AI数字人在各种场景中的应用,如在线教育、客服支持、娱乐互动等。
- 市场推广:通过广告、合作伙伴关系、社交媒体等方式推广AI数字人的应用。
- 用户反馈收集:收集用户的反馈,不断优化AI数字人的功能和用户体验。
总之,制作AI智能数字人是一个复杂的过程,需要跨学科的知识和技术。通过上述步骤,可以逐步实现一个高效、智能的数字人,为用户提供有价值的服务。